Полная документация по CMS Drupal (создание сайта, локализация)

Установка и настройка сайта, а также системного окружения. Исключая вопросы программирования новых модулей и тем.

См. документацию на английском: http://drupal.org/node/258

Скопировать файлы на сервер

Задача: 

Нужно скопировать (закачать) файл или файлы на сервер.

Варианты

  • Использовать FTP
  • Использовать SCP
  • Копирование через SSH
  • Файловый менеджер в панели управления хостингом

Использовать FTP

Для подключения к FTP-серверу нужен FTP-клиент. Их много, у них разный интерфейс, доп. возможности и лицензия. Если у вас ничего под рукой нет, то можно воспользоваться ]]>FileZilla]]>. Есть версия для любой операционной системы (Windows, Linux, Mac). Удобный интерфейс на русском языке.

читать далее

Горизонтальное выравнивание элементов

Задача: 

Нужно горизонтально центрировать (выровнять по горизонтали) элементы страницы.

Возможны несколько случаев. Рассмотрим их по очереди:

Горизонтальное центрирование блока фиксированной С?РёСЂРёРЅС‹

<div id="wrapper">
   <div id="main">
      Content
   </div>
</div>

Вывод списка нод вместо анонсов на странице термина

Задача: 

Вывести список всех нод определённого словаря таксономии с разделением этого списка по типам материалов.

читать далее

Переопределение страницы термина таксономии

Задача: 

Нужно заменить список анонсов нод на странице термина произвольным контентом.

На странице термина таксономии по умолчанию выводятся анонсы нод, в которых указан этот тег.
Нужно переопределить вывод контента на этой странице.

читать далее

FlashVideo: конвертация и воспроизведение видео на сайте

Модуль позволяет конвертировать видео-файлы, которые загружаются на сайт, если на сервере установлена библиотека ffmpeg. Также модуль выводит плейер и обеспечивает всю работу с видео.

Установка модуля: 

В файле .htaccess включить следующие параметры:

php_value post_max_size 100M
php_value upload_max_filesize 100M
php_value max_execution_time 1000
php_value max_input_time 1000

Настройка модуля: 

Модуль получает файлы с помощью одного из этих модулей:

Быстрое редактирование терминов таксономии

Задача: 

Нужно вывести на странице термина таксономии ссылку для быстрого перехода к редактированию термина.

Решение:
Решение достаточно простое - одна строчка в шаблоне темы, - но становится намного удобнее работать!
Кроме того, у каждого термина есть описание. Если это описание заполнено, то при наведении мыши на термин во всплывающей подсказке показывается текст этого описания...

читать далее

Noindex External Links: запрет индексации внешних ссылок

Описание с сайта

Модуль позволяет полностью закрыть внешние ссылки на сайте от индексации и сохранить их валидность.

Модуль реализующий обратный счетчик символов (Осталось XXX символов) 6.X

Для чего:
Надо при вводе текста контролировать и показывать пользователю сколько осталось символов.

Установка:
1) Установить модуль;
2) Настроить для каких страниц и для каких textarea (текстовых полей) включать счетчик на странице
admin/settings/limit_textarea

P.S. Пригодится для доски объявлений. Модуль скачивать внизу.

Модуль для выполнения действий по таймеру.

Потребовалось РїРѕ истечении 10 дней, после публикации материала автоматически снять материал СЃ публикации (unpublish) Рё отправить РѕР± этом РїРёСЃСЊРјР° автору Рё администратору, модуль http://drupal.org/project/sched_act для 6 - РЅРµ выпущен, написал небольС?РѕР№ СЃРІРѕР№.
Что делает ? С его помощью удалось по установленному значению таймера в действии переходить из одного состоянии документооборота (workflow) в другой и при этом выполняются нужные действия.
Требования:
Drupal 6;
модуль http://drupal.org/project/workflow;
регулярный запуск cron.php
Модуль в аттаче, описание примера в readme
Работает на "живом" сайте, замечания и пожелания приветствуются :)

RSS-материал